计算机思维是什么1000字
发布网友
发布时间:2022-04-28 22:46
我来回答
共1个回答
热心网友
时间:2022-06-24 12:49
计算机思维是什么
1 引言
在21世纪的今天,高职高专类院校计算机教学在内容和课程体系方面已有明显的改进,但在教学方法和手段方面进展依然较为缓慢。特别是传统的计算机学科教学模式,不管是教学手段还是教学方法上,都存在诸多弊端,为了能够适应现今高职高专学生的素质能力水平和今后就业的需求,改变旧的教学模式已刻不容缓。笔者在反思传统的计算机教学观念同时,不断研究并探索出有效、主动、开放的教学模式,本文对新型的“教、学、做”教学模式进行了剖析,力图为高职高专新的计算机学科教学模式的实施提供理论依据。
2 对传统计算机教学模式的反思
1、课本内容“不容侵犯”
传统计算机教育认为,只要理解记住了课本知识,就可以套用它去应付实际问题。然而,实际问题总是具体的,在不同时间、地点会有很大的差别。例如能够流畅地背诵操作系统的完整概念,却不知道家里使用的Windows XP就是微软公司最新的操作系统。
2、教学就是知识的复制和粘贴
传统计算机教育认为,要把结论交给学生背诵,以后需要的时候提取出来加以应用。即便让学生上机实习,其主要目的也是为传递知识、验证知识而已,完全忽略了学生本身的素质水平和接受能力,根本无法让学生将所学转变为自己的“学识”、“主见”和“思想”。
3、忽略学生已有的认知能力和知识经验
传统计算机教育总认为在教学之前,学生对所要学习的主题基本上是无知的或片面的,但其实,在今天计算机已经从“娃娃抓起”的年代,学生并不是空着脑袋走进教室的,学生在某些操作层面上认知能力和经验(例如游戏、QQ等)不可小视,学生完全能用更简便更有效的方法来代替教材中的某些操作步骤,循规蹈矩的教学反倒落后了。
3 教、学、做教学模式分析
“教、学、做”教学模式认为,教学不仅仅是知识灌输和训练的工具,它应该是发展认知的手段。教学活动的实施应该让教师和学生的积极性都得到极大的尊重,应该鼓励学生积极参与教学活动。其构架主要包括:
1、教师如何“教”
在传统计算机教学中几乎千篇一律都是先理论后实践。但是理论往往是复杂抽象、难以理解的,如数据库中的三种模式和它们之间的两种映射,数据库设计的第一范式、第二范式等,而实际操作中相对来得容易理解而且显得简单。而“教、学、做”模式则提倡先简单地讲解,使学生可以有一个朦胧的了解即可,然后根据操作的深入,开始对涉及的理论加以针对性的讲解,最后进行归纳,将理论和操作融合起来讲解,使学生逐步通过操作过程来加深对理论的推理、分析后达到自觉地理解和掌握。
2、学生如何“学”
“教、学、做”模式认为,教师要从“教育者”角色转到“引导者”角色上来,例如在WORD的教学中用计划中的1/4教学时间把教材中的内容作为“引导性”讲解,而把教学时间的3/4留给了学习中的主体--学生,由他们根据自己对WORD的使用经验开发实用性强,但在一般教材中没有提及的功能,并为每个开发者提供演示、讲解的机会,并提倡学生对每个被开发的功能“评头论足”,学生完全根据自己的知识框架发挥各自的优势来投入学习,对课程的理解和掌握是高层次和有深度的。
此外,在课程讲解和任务布置时还可以引用协作学习的概念和实践。协作学习是由多个学生针对同一学习任务彼此交换信息和合作,以达到对所学知识的深刻理解与掌握。协作学习对提高学习效果,形成学习的批判性思维和创造性思维,以及学生间的沟通能力等都有明显的积极作用。教师在讲课时,一方面要通过少而精的讲述,把握整个教学过程的内容和方向,另一方面要尽可能保留一些与旧知识相似规律的新知识,引导学生自己去发现它,在可能的条件下,组织学生开展讨论与交流,并针对学生中出现较多的问题和困难,在教授中与学生共同分析和讨论,使学生在获得对自身能力的自信感的同时,对知识的理解也会进一步加深。
3、学生如何“做”
从“授人以鱼”转到“授人以渔”,把主要任务放到教给学生学习的方法上来,把重点放在学生分析问题、解决问题的能力和创新精神的培养上。例如在数据库技术的教学过程中学生特别关注具体的操作步骤,而对数据库的设计过程、原理和方法缺乏兴趣。通过“差别教育”,选择一组学生使其在通晓设计原理和方法的基础上完成更为完善和合理的数据库模型,以此为例,使全体学生感觉到“鱼”和“渔”的价值。
4、知识考核方法
“教、学、做”教学模式认为,知识的传授和接纳只是过程,能够运用知识解决问题才是目的,建议重新确立操作能力、解决问题能力的地位,具体做法为加大平时成绩在课程中的比例(30%到50%)。这种考核措施能够改变传统的“考分=能力”的错误观念,使那些不擅背书但技能一流的学生重拾信心,同时,也只有这样,才能真正实现计算机教学的最初目的--学以致用。
4 教、学、做模式的环境分析
“教、学、做”教学模式提倡教师要善于鼓励学生大胆质疑,使学生逐步具有创新的意识。例如在教学过程中,当讲解某一操作步骤时候,常有学生提出不同见解,不管其观点正确与否,教师不应只是简单的否定,而应引导学生审视其观点,引导其得出正确的结论,为学生创造真正的、自主的学习环境。教师可以采用以下方式:
1、启迪式引导
教师采用各种有效方式启发引导学生,激发学生的兴趣。如在理论课可以采用思路的提示、发散性思考、广泛性讨论、鼓励性猜测等方式启发引导学生。例如在讲操作系统时,组织学生对Windows2000和XP的正反方的辩论等,激发学生的思考与创意,培养学生的发散性思维。
2、问题式推进
每一个教学任务都分成两个层次,易解的和有难度的,课堂上只讲解前者,把后者留给学生,在实践操作上给点启示,最终由部分学生独立完成,再由学生在课堂上给全体学生讲解,推进全体学生独立解决问题的能力。通过启发式教学,使学生的思维活跃起来,鼓励学生从不同角度思考问题,用不同方法解决问题,促进学生创造性思维的发展。
3、资源式深化
在基本解决问题的基础上,要求学生利用各类资源进行深化学习。如可以指导学生利用所掌握的网络通讯操作技能和信息检索能力,来获取更多、更全面的资料来补充和加深认识课程内容。还可以在各教学单位之间组织一定主题的竞赛活动,对教师创新教育给予检验的同时,也对学生的创新成就进行奖励,并将优秀作品在内部网络上交流,这不仅为学生提供自主性、创造性和个性化表现的平台,还可在校园中形成浓郁的崇尚创新、尊重创新人才的氛围。
5 结语
本文中所分析的“教、学、做”教学模式是仅是目前的计算机教学中较先进的一种,是计算机学科教学发展到现阶段的必然产物,计算机教学模式势必会根据计算机技术的发展和社会实际需要不断地进行改革和调整,做到“与时俱进”。放眼未来,计算机正日益成为最普遍的工具,这决定了计算机教学改革将是教育改革的前提和基础,是信息社会发展的基本要求和必然结果。因此,我们仍需继续探索,不断寻找更科学的计算机教学方法。